Transaction 103923a3bf51ad16992808f60977009f34a707f882a16b16bcc41fa76764fa2c
1 Input
2 Outputs
- 103923a3bf51ad16992808f60977009f34a707f882a16b16bcc41fa76764fa2c:0
- 103923a3bf51ad16992808f60977009f34a707f882a16b16bcc41fa76764fa2c:1
value 149325
address 1DgRmbyDXd86Ug27TdHHrN81pGWGpDXHgo
value 12500000
address 1MGed9gLYivXybcDoM3C1QB4cdfvJrW3RK